With fans torn on John Terry and those concerns being largely irrelevant as he’s now completed (or soon will) a deal with Russian side Spartak Moscow, Aston Villa have also been linked in recent times with a move for former player James Collins.

It was the weekend and new speculation was required to feed the masses and the Mirror duly obliged and went back into the archives for rumours linking us with a move for former Leicester City title winner Robert Huth.

As if by magic, manager Steve Bruce has now turned his attentions to the 34-year-old German, and they suggested that a deal would be done for him before the end of this evening.

I have no idea if there’s any truth to this, Huth isn’t new on the rumour mill is he. If nothing is announced by 8pm though expect well placed ‘sources’ to link us with a return for Carlos Cuellar as he’s without a club at the moment and looking for a new deal as well.

The debate about the decision to let Tommy Elphick leave isn’t going to go away soon as even if Huth arrives and is maybe followed by Collins, we are still woefully short at centre-half in my humble.
